Conor Mullen Colonel (born February 15, 1980 in Omaha , Nebraska ) is an American musician.

Conor Oberst started making music at the age of 13. According to his own account, he recorded his first song with a children's cassette recorder and an acoustic guitar. In the same year he founded the label Lumberjack Records, now known as Saddle Creek, with his brother Justin .

From 1995 to 1997 he played guitar and singer with Commander Venus . In 1996, Oberst also started with Magnetas and that year also became a member of Park Ave , where he was on drums . At 17 he was already a full-time musician.

In 1997 he released a split single for the first time (with Squadcar 96 ) under the name Bright Eyes . As a result, he released several albums, EPs and singles under this name - initially as a one-man project but soon also with a full orchestra or guest musicians such as country singer Emmylou Harris . In addition, Mike Mogis and Nate Walcott became permanent band members.

From 2001, Oberst was also the singer of the band Desaparecidos , which played emolastic indie rock and broke up in 2002. The band has been active again since 2012 and released a new album in 2015.

With the album I'm Wide Awake, It's Morning , Bright Eyes made it to number 10 on the American album charts in 2005 . In addition, the singles Lua and Take It Easy (Love Nothing) reached number one and two of the Hot 100 singles sales in the USA at the same time .

On August 1, 2008, Conor Oberst released a self-titled solo album. The recordings for this took place within a month in Tepoztlán , Mexico . As a backing band he was supported by the specially founded Mystic Valley Band , which also consists of musicians who have already participated in Bright Eyes publications. While the album only bore his name, which appeared in 2009 follow-up album is Outer South with Conor Oberst and the Mystic Valley band titled. It also contains songs by the other band members.

Oberst is also one of four members of the "folk supergroup" Monsters of Folk . The other members are Jim James from My Morning Jacket , M. Ward and Mike Mogis , who was also a permanent member of Bright Eyes. The quartet released their debut album on September 22, 2009. At the beginning of 2011, The People's Key was released again after a break of almost four years, a Bright Eyes album.

On May 19, 2014 Conor Oberst released his sixth solo album entitled Upside Down Mountain on Nonesuch Records

Oberst had a role as an extra, as a reading customer, in Millie's Coffee Shop (1:04:16), in the film Shrink , in which Kevin Spacey played the lead role.

In 2018 he founded the duo Better Oblivion Community Center with Phoebe Bridgers , which released a debut album of the same name in 2019.
